The results of the 18th International Choir Festival “Tallinn 2025”

Grand Prix of Tallinn City – The Epiphoni Consort (UK)        

Children’s choirs

I Children’s Choir of Estonian Television (Estonia)                     92,2

II Coro Voci Bianche Garda Trentino (Italy)                                  86,6

Youth choirs

I E STuudio Girls’ Choir (Estonia)                                                     91,6     

II Girls’ Choir of Musamari Choral Studio (Estonia)                   88,6                   

III Mixed Choir of Tallinn French Lyceum (Estonia)                    76,8

Equal voices choirs

I Female Chamber Choir Sireen (Estonia)                                                                                91

II/III Academic Female Choir of Tallinn University of Technology (Estonia)            88

II/III Dulciana Vocal Ensemble (Ireland)                                                                                    88

Tartu Academic Male Choir (Estonia)                                                                         82,2

Mixed choirs

I Chamber Choir of Tartu University (Estonia)                                           92,8

II Mixed Choir Norise (Latvia)                                                                         90

III Gdansk University Choir (Poland)                                                             88

Tartu Students’ Mixed Choir (Estonia)                                                         86

Tartu Youth Choir (Estonia)                                                                             78,2

Chamber choirs

I The Epiphoni Consort (UK)                                                                            95,2*

II Chamber Choir Glasis (Slovenia)                                                                92,2

III E STuudio Chamber Choir (Estonia)                                                         92

Chamber Choir Näsi (Finland)                                                           91

Academic Choir of Velenje (Slovenia)                                                          90,4

Chamber Choir NOX (Finland)                                                          90,2

Tallinn Chamber Choir (Estonia)                                                                    89,4

Contemporary music category

I E STuudio Chamber Choir (Estonia)                                                           92,4

II Chamber Choir Encore (Estonia)                                                                92

III Chamber Choir NOX (Finland)                                                                   91,4

Tartu University Chamber Choir (Estonia)                                                  90,8

Dulciana Vocal Ensemble (Ireland)                                                               89,4

Chamber Choir Näsi (Finland)                                                          88,6

Chamber Choir Glasis (Slovenia)                                                                   88,4*

Academic Choir of Velenje (Slovenia)                                            87,2

Gdansk University Choir (Poland)                                                                 84,8***

Special prizes

Estonian Choral Conductors Association’s special prize for the best conductor – Triin Koch

Outstanding young conductor – Laura Štoma

Special prize for the outstanding performance of Laura Jekabsone „Rasa“ – Mixed Choir Norise

The best interpretation of compulsory piece – Chamber Choir Näsi

Special prize from Cantemus International Choral Festival – E Stuudio Chamber Choir

Special prize in the category of contemporary music for the best performance of the compulsory piece – Chamber Choir NOX

* 1 point reduced because of the longer program

*** 2 points reduced because of the longer program
